Library Launches Card Sign-Up Month With Downtown Pittsfield Discounts
The Berkshire Athenaeum is gearing up for National Library Card Sign-Up Month this September, teaming with Downtown Pittsfield, Inc. to offer residents savings for signing up or renewing a library card, the library announced Wednesday.
COMMUNITY & ARTS
The Berkshire Athenaeum has partnered with Downtown Pittsfield, Inc. to turn National Library Card Sign-Up Month into a savings drive for residents. Cardholders who sign up or renew during September will be eligible for discounts at participating downtown businesses, part of a push to link the library's services to the city's commercial core.
The library also marked a smaller milestone Wednesday evening, holding a release party from 5:30 to 6:30 p.m. to unveil a new 3D printer now available for public use at the Athenaeum.
